The tools at a glance
TopicalMap AI
Generates 800 to 1,200 clustered keywords with real search volume and content briefs in about one minute
TopicalMap AI turns a single seed topic into a full content plan: 800 to 1,200 keywords grouped into semantic clusters, each with real search volume, a difficulty score, and a content brief covering suggested headings and key questions. The whole process runs in roughly a minute per topic, driven by live keyword data rather than a cached database.
The free tier includes 3 complete maps with no credit card required, a real evaluation path rather than a locked demo. White-label PDF export becomes available on the $46/month Starter plan (annual billing), and exports also cover CSV and Google Docs for teams that prefer to work in a spreadsheet or shared doc.
TopicalMap AI has no rank tracking, no SERP analysis, and no backlink data, so it does not compete with Wincher on Wincher's core job. API access is gated to the Pro tier at $86/month and above, and the tool is explicitly positioned to be used alongside a rank tracker rather than replace one.

Wincher
Search visibility platform with daily rank tracking, local SEO, and automated PDF reporting
Wincher is a rank tracking platform used by over 700,000 marketers, built around daily keyword position updates, AI-assisted keyword suggestions, and unlimited local and regional tracking. The interface stays deliberately narrow: monitor what you have, rather than plan what to write next.
API access lets developers pull ranking data into custom dashboards, and a native Looker Studio connector extends that further, combining Wincher's rank data with GA4 and Search Console inside one reporting view. Scheduled PDF reports handle recurring stakeholder updates without manual exports.
Wincher does not publish pricing, every tier requires contacting sales, and it does not offer white-label reporting on standard plans by its own admission. There is also no keyword clustering, no content brief generation, and no AI visibility tracking, so it complements a content planning tool like TopicalMap AI rather than replacing one.

Which should you choose?
These tools sit at opposite ends of the content lifecycle. TopicalMap AI helps decide what to write and how to structure it, with a free tier that makes trying it essentially risk-free. Wincher tracks how what you've already published is ranking day to day, with strong local coverage and BI reporting, but no planning or clustering features at all. A team doing both content planning and performance monitoring will likely need both, since neither covers the other's job.

Frequently asked questions
Can TopicalMap AI track keyword rankings like Wincher?
No. TopicalMap AI focuses on generating clustered keyword maps and content briefs from a seed topic and does not track live search rankings. Wincher is the rank tracking tool of the two, updating positions daily.
Does Wincher help with content planning or topic clustering?
Not in the way TopicalMap AI does. Wincher's keyword tool surfaces AI-assisted suggestions tied to search volume and difficulty, but it does not group keywords into semantic clusters or generate a content brief per topic the way TopicalMap AI does automatically.
Why is Wincher's pricing not listed while TopicalMap AI's is?
Wincher requires contacting sales for a quote across all three of its tiers, Starter, Professional, and Agency. TopicalMap AI publishes exact pricing for every tier, including a free plan with 3 topical maps, making it easier to evaluate without a sales conversation.
Is there a free way to try either tool?
TopicalMap AI offers a free tier with 3 complete topical maps and no credit card required. Wincher does not advertise a free tier; every plan requires contacting sales.
Do TopicalMap AI or Wincher track AI search visibility?
No. Neither tool tracks brand visibility in ChatGPT, Gemini, or Google AI Overviews. TopicalMap AI focuses on keyword clustering and content planning, while Wincher focuses on traditional Google rank tracking.
